CPI demands permanent solution to flood problems of Bihar

Patna, June 6 (UNI) Suspecting massive administrative loot of funds in the name of flood in Bihar, the Communist Party of India (CPI) demanded the Centre find a permanent solution to the annual menace, saying the state can progress and fetch major investments only after effective solution to the problem.
CPI state secretary Ramnaresh Pandey told media on Friday that 22 districts of the state face the tragedy of floods every year. Crops worth crores of rupees get damaged and hundreds of people lose their lives. During the last 20 years of Nitish Kumar's tenure, more than 2,500 people died due to floods, he said.
Even after such a huge loss, the Modi government has yet not announced any project for a permanent solution to the problem.
Suggesting construction of multipurpose high dams on rivers Kosi, Kamla and Bagmati in Nepal for permanent solution to the flood problem of Bihar, the CPI leader said that being associated with external affairs, it is a matter of the Central Government. But the Modi government never took seriously the flood problem of Bihar.
He said that the Patna High Court had also passed an order for a permanent solution to the flood problem, but the Centre was silent on it.
The CPI leader alleged massive loot of the state exchequer by the administration in the name of flood victims, flood control and flood relief every year.
Describing floods as a major hurdle in the development of Bihar, he said the state will progress and can fetch investments only after a permanent solution was evolved.
The construction of dams cannot solve the problem as it would only result in siltation of rivers, he added.
